Ford 6000 CD producer: Visteon

Pin Designations are:

Connector A - Speakers and Power


Pin 1 Right Rear + Pin 5 Right Rear – Pin 9 CAN + Pin 13 Alarm Sense
Pin 2 Right Front + Pin 6 Right Front – Pin 10 CAN – Pin 14 Illumination
Pin 3 Left Front + Pin 7 Left Front – Pin 11 Pin 15 Batt +
Pin 4 Left Rear + Pin 8 Left Rear – Pin 12 Gnd Pin 16 Ign Sense
(Accessory)

Connector B - Aux 1 Connector C - Aux 2


Pin 1 Mono + Pin 7 Mono – Pin 1 RSE L + Pin 7 RSE L –
Pin 2 Sw A + Pin 8 SWC Gnd Pin 2 RSE R + Pin 8 RSE R –
Pin 3 Aux L + Pin 9 Aux L – Pin 3 Mono 2 + Pin 9 Mono 2 –
Pin 4 Aux R + Pin 10 Aux R – Pin 4 Sub W + Pin 10 Sub W –
Pin 5 PTA Pin 11 Rev sense Pin 5 Aux 2 L Pin 11 Aux 2 R
Pin 6 SWC Pin 12 (AVC) Pin 6 Audio Gnd Pin 12 Mic.

Please note that the table above details all possible Pin Outs. The low and high series radios do not use
all the pins:

GREEN HIGHLIGHT – Low and High Series Focus C-Max & Mondeo
BLUE HIGHLIGHT - Low and High Series Mondeo & Nav. Units only
PINK HIGHLIGHT - High Series radios only
RED HIGHLIGHT - Not Used
PTA = Phone mute input
Mono + & - = Phone audio input
Pin --- Color --- Stripe --- Function

Harness 1

1 --- White - Black Left front +


2 --- Gray - Black Left front -
3 --- White - Purple Left rear +
4 --- Gray - White Left rear -
5 --- White - Red Right front +
6 --- Gray - Red Right front -
7 --- White -(none) Right rear +
8 --- Gray - (none) Right rear -

Harness 2

1 --- (not used)


2 --- Black - Green Radio Ground
3 --- (not used)
4 --- Orange (thin) - Black Radio Illumination
5 --- Green - Yellow Radio switch
6 --- Black – Yellow Radio Ground
7 --- Orange (thick) - Black Radio 12V

Harness 3

1 --- White - Green Speed sensor*


2 --- (not used)
3 --- (not used)
4 --- (not used)
5 --- (not used)
6 --- (not used)

* The speed sensor wire is for the Speed controlled volume feature of these radios. I have no earthly idea
why there are two different ground wires (black/green, black/yellow), but that is the way it is.
